3-4 Clutch Plate Travel Check

- Use feeler gauges to check the 3rd and 4th clutch plate travel.
- Check the travel between the selective backing plate (655) and the first fiber plate assembly (654A).
The 3rd and 4th clutch plate travel should be:
Specification:
- Five plate - 0.99-2.14 mm (0.038-0.084 in)
- Six plate - 0.90-2.10 mm (0.035-0.082 in)
- Seven plate - 1.12-2.04 mm (0.044-0.080 in)
- Select the proper 3rd and 4th clutch selective backing plate to obtain the correct travel. Refer to Third and Fourth Clutch Backing Plate Selection .
